119.23.87.110

sendfromchina.com - China Fulfillment Center | Get better China Fulfillment Services with SFC

Daily visitors: 1 068

Keywords: send from china, vehicles with third row seating, sendfromchina, china warehouse, sfc tracking, China fulfillment, send from china...

wx.sfcservice.com - 三态速递

Sites previously hosted on this IP:

account.suntekcorps.com - 三态股份信息化管理平台